HOW TO USE
HOW TO USE
Preparation before Operation
● “Transportation” and “Evacuation of the air
in the cylinder” should be done in view of
the following environment of usage.
① Do not use the machine in rain or in areas
where water may enter into the machine.
A fan is built into the machine for cooling
and it may suck water.
② The recovery machine should be used in a
well-ventilated area.
When the machine is used in a poor
ventilated area, you may be choked from
lack of oxygen in case of refrigerant leak.
③ Keep fire away to prevent phosgene (highly
toxic substance) being generated.
④ Combustible gases (hydrocarbon system)
cannot be recovered.
I f a n y c o m b u s t i b l e g a s e s [ a m m o n i a ,
hydrocarbon (propane, isobutene) and so
on] enter into the recovery machine, it may
catch fire and may explode.
● Please note the following points before use.
① C h e c k t h e t y p e o f r e f r i g e r a n t t o b e
recovered.
② Evacuate the air from the refrigerant
recovery machine, charging hoses and
recovery cylinder (hereinafter called
recovery machine, hoses and cylinder).
③ Install a filter or a filter dryer at the suction
port of the recovery machine.
④ Set the valve to the “⓪ START” position before
starting the recovery machine.
⑤ Abnormal noise may be heard when a large
amount of damp refrigerant enters into the
compressor during liquid recovery.
Throttle the valve on the manifold until the
noise cannot be heard.
⑥ Do not close the valve of the hose or the
valve of the cylinder before stopping the
recovery machine during operation.
The gauge may be damaged.
Close the system side valve of manifold,
turn “OFF” the machine after set the valve
to “⓪ START”.
⑦ The temperature of the cylinder may rise
when the ambient temperature is high or
R410A is recovered.
Lower the temperature and pressure of the
cylinder according to “page 11 4) Helpful
Information” and “page 19 Recovery
Procedure of R410A or When the Pressure
of Refrigerant is High”.
⑧ Do not enter the air into the hoses and the
cylinder.
When the cylinder contains air, evacuate
the air from the vapor valve referring to
the chart of saturation temperature and
pressure.
The air can be evacuated before discharging
the refrigerant.
⑨ Use an oil separator when refrigerant with a
large amount of oil is recovered.
The compressor may be damaged when a
large amount of oil is recovered.
⑩ Do not recover virgin refrigerant.
The compressor may be damaged if virgin
refrigerant is recovered for a long time.
If you need to recover virgin refrigerant, put
some additional oil in the compressor.
⑪ Do not recover from air conditioners in
which any sealant has ever been charged.
The sealant may clog the valves or the
compressor and the recovery machine may
be damaged.
⑫ Do not evacuate the air from the cylinder by
using the recovery machine.
The compressor may be damaged if it is run
for a long time under vacuum.
⑬ When starting the machine, it may not start
unless the pressure in the compressor is
equalized.
Start the machine after equalizing the
p r e s s u r e a t t h e d i s c h a r g e s i d e a n d
the pressure at the suction side of the
compressor according to “page 20 How to
Restart the Recovery Machine”.
